If you're looking for a small electric wheelchair, then consider the WHILL Model F. This wheelchair can be folded in a matter of seconds and is designed to fit inside the trunk of your vehicle or in a closet. Its lightweight materials, like carbon fiber and aluminum, make it easy to carry around and keep in storage.

While standard power wheelchairs can be difficult to maneuver in tight spaces, the WHILL Model F was designed to be small and portable. Its lightweight design and small wheels allow it to fit in narrow hallways, elevators and other tight spaces. It can also be easily transported on trains, buses taxis, cruise ships, taxis and even airplanes.

The WHILL Model F can be easily broken into three pieces for storage and transport. The chassis, frame, and motors can be separated without tools, making it simple to carry in a trunk or the back of a vehicle. The battery is also separate from the rest of the device so you can replace it quickly if it runs out.

Compact

Whether traveling by car, plane, train or bus, it's crucial to be able to fold your mobility aid when it's not in use. This makes it much easier to transport and store for caregivers or users with weaker muscles. Portable electric wheelchairs were created to take this into consideration, as they are compact when not in use and can be easily stowed away. This also makes it easy to maneuver them through restricted spaces, like the trunk of a vehicle or narrow hallways.

When you are looking for a light electric wheelchair that folds, it's important to look at all of the options and features available. Make sure that the chair is comfortable and meets the requirements of the user, especially in terms of seat width and height. Consider how easily and quickly the chair folds, and also its overall dimensions. Be sure to check if the chair comes with any additional features for comfort and safety.

The Model F of WHILL is a light power wheelchair that can be folded in a matter of seconds and wheeled into the trunk of a car or backseat. Its compact design and FAA approval for air travel means it can be used on buses, trains taxis, cruise ships and even on flights. In addition to its ease of use it comes with a user-friendly application that lets users remotely control their WHILL and access relevant information, including speed settings and battery levels. The app can also be used to lock the wheelchair and set the speed limit, which is ideal for public spaces and travel.
